Florent Georges wrote:
But I just installed it and test it against the set of XSLT2 scripts
I'm currently developing, and I got no output at all. The only error message
I got is "****************". I didn't find a "verbose" nor "trace"
option.
Well, while AltovaXML can be used as a stand-alone XSLT 2.0 processor, from a
development and debugging perspective it's desinged to tightly integrate into
XMLSpy. So from the command-line there is no Verbose or Trace option.
These kind of debugging features are found inside of XMLSpy though. For
example, XMLSpy provides many debugging options for XSLT 2.0 including
breakpoints, tracepoints, template profiling, 3-pane split-screen view
(XML/XSLT/Output), XPath evaluation, call-stack information, etc.
